Output 10a84785d62e4a40375ca093e699bc532a13aad84ac2eb0e2576fde8b66a828d:8

value
174688502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ed346120938f4dd077e46aa256d716dfebe5bf3 OP_EQUAL
address
MF5x2wvtPLpX7XfXDeTnLKZVvaH62fc9np
transaction
10a84785d62e4a40375ca093e699bc532a13aad84ac2eb0e2576fde8b66a828d
spent
true